"I just finished a record with Mudcrutch, my old band before the Heartbreakers. I am over the moon about it. I couldn't have hoped for it to be as good as it came out." In summer 2007, Tom Petty reunited Mudcrutch, consisting of himself, Heartbreakers Mike Campbell and Benmont Tench, original bandmember Tom Leadon, and Randall Marsh, who joined when Mudcrutch first went to Los Angeles in search of a record deal in the early 70s. Mudcrutch-- it's about time!
Disclosure: I first heard Tom Petty play with the Sundowners across the street from UF at the KA house while in Jr. High School. This group included Benmont Tench(child prodigy on keyboard), Richie Hinson, and Dennis Lee. Watched them develop musically with Byrds influence(12 string electric guitar, etc)at venues such as The Place downtown Gville. Epics were the next group I recall and included Tom Leadon (Bernie's younger brother) playing lead with TP on bass. Flash forward to 1976-7: I walk into a record store in Houston and featured front-and-center were multiple copies of TP & Heartbreakers first album with his mug prominently displayed. Unbelievable! Naturally I had to buy it. Have kept up with TP and the guys from afar all these years. Imagine the joy of reading about the Mudcrutch reunion project after all this time! Got the album right away and have been listening frequently since. Needless to say, I believe TP and the guys have done it again! This guy has the knack. More Southern/countrified than I recall, but a very enjoyable listen and an insight to the roots of this gem of an artist. Mrs. Murphree would be proud!
